%N A333788 Semiprimes whose both factors are Fermat primes.
%C A333788 Product of two, not necessarily distinct Fermat primes.
%C A333788 For the finiteness or non-finiteness of this sequence, see A019434.
%C A333788 Most terms are binary palindromes (in A006995), except among the fifteen known terms, these squares > 9 are not: 25, 289, 66049, 4295098369.
